Why Wheat Ridge Homes Are Different
Wheat Ridge sits at about 5,400 feet, tucked between the hogback ridges and the floodplain of Clear Creek, and its housing stock tells the story of mid-century expansion across the Denver metro. The original knob-sets in many of these homes have outlived their manufacturers’ support, while chinook winds that swing temperatures 40°F in a single day cause wooden door frames to expand and contract aggressively. North- and west-facing garage side entries, standard on mid-century floor plans, freeze hard through winter with no solar warming. We build all of this into our phone quotes.

Lock Change
In Wheat Ridge, a lock change usually means more than swapping hardware. The hollow-core or original solid-wood entry doors common in both zip codes have settled over sixty years, been repainted repeatedly, or had strike plates shimmed by previous owners. We remove the old lock, correct frame and strike-plate alignment, and install new hardware so it operates smoothly. A standard lock change runs $120-$220 per door, including rekeying to match your key.
Deadbolt Installation
Many Wheat Ridge ranch homes were built with only a knob-set on the front door, no deadbolt at all. Others have a deadbolt that was added later and never aligned properly with the strike plate. Our deadbolt installation service is $140-$260, including a Schlage B560 or comparable grade-2 deadbolt, proper boring if needed, and frame correction. Because chinook winds cause repeated expansion and contraction of wooden door frames here, we take extra time to ensure the bolt throws cleanly into a reinforced strike box.

I have a 1960s Kwikset knob-set. Can you rekey it?
Usually not. The 400-series and similar vintage Kwikset bodies common in 80033 ranches use pin configurations and keyways that most modern rekey kits no longer support. We typically quote replacement with new Schlage or Kwikset deadbolts and lever sets that fit the same prep holes. The phone quote accounts for this possibility so you’re not caught off guard. Broken Key Extraction
Keys snap in locks for two reasons in Wheat Ridge: brittle metal fatigued by decades of use, or forced turning in a lock whose pins are already binding from frame misalignment. We extract broken key fragments without damaging the cylinder when possible, but we’re upfront when the lock itself is the problem. Broken key extraction runs $75-$140, including extraction; replacement lock is additional if needed.
My garage side door lock is frozen; is that common in Wheat Ridge?
Yes, extremely common - north- and west-facing garage side entries are standard on mid-century ranch floor plans here and receive minimal winter sun, so cylinders freeze hard after chinook temperature drops. We carry cylinder de-icers and heat guns, but we also check whether the lock’s internal tolerances are worn enough that replacement makes more sense than repeated service calls.
